The YC hands down. It's a lot more quiet over there, the BC shares a check in desk with the BCV so it's always pretty crowded over there. Plus at the YC all the rooms have full balconys over at the BC some of them are standing room only.
 


I recommend the BC if you are w. young children. It's theme is a Cape Cod beach resort so it is much more casual.

The YC is more formal and at times you may find during your stay it is holding conventions.
